摘 要:目前对平面不规则结构扭转振动效应研究集中于弹性阶段,对结构非弹性受力阶段的扭转效应控制缺乏明确的评价方法和指标。提出通过考察θr/u在弹塑性阶段的变化来对结构扭转振动响应进行评价,并以此为基础定义了结构弹塑性扭转振动效应的敛散性。采用PERFORM-3D对三种典型的结构平面布置进行弹塑性扭转振动效应敛散性计算,对计算结果进行对比分析,验证了敛散性分析对结构弹塑性扭转振动效应评价的有效性和必要性,并进一步对结构弹塑性扭转振动效应敛散性的主要影响因素进行简要分析。最后,探讨了敛散性指标作为结构的弹塑性扭转振动效应评价指标的合理性和优越性。Current studies of the torsional vibration effect in symmetric buildings focus on the elastic stage and there is no clear evaluation methods or index for inelastic torsional effect control .This paper proposed a method to evaluate torsional vibration effect by investigating variation of θr/u.A convergence index of elasto-plastic torsional effect in asymmetric buildings was also defined .Torsional vibration effect convergence calcula-tion was finished for three typical buildings by using PERFORM-3 D.Calculation results were analyzed to veri-fy the necessity and effectiveness of convergence index .A brief analysis on main factors of convergence index was carried out .Finally, the rationality and superiority of convergence index as a structural elasto-plastic tor-sional vibration effect evaluation index were discussed .
